clear halogens will be just as bright as the lights you have now. instead of the lenses being foggy like you have now they are clear like the CLK halogens. the BIX have projector beams and are HID lights. they are brighter than halogen lights and both high beam and low beam are HID.

A very important thing that has been left out from previous comments is that if you go the Bi-Xenon route you also have to go to a Mercedes dealer and have them reprogram your on-board computer to recognize the the new lights. Without this step, THEY WON'T WORK!

Also from what I've seen from previous post regarding the mod, some MB dealers refuse or at the very least will charge you for the reprogramming. I suggest that even before you go the Bi-Xenon route, check with your local MB dealer(s) if they are willing to do the programming and if so, how much.

finalheaven...lemme try and help citronc230k_03 clarify things for you...

there are the clear halogen headlamps and the clear bi-xenon headlamps.

the clear halogens are the ones found on the 2005 C models and are basic halogen headlamps (the same on your car now, except with a clear cover and not the "frosted" cover on your car now). The clear halogens can be purchased for between $400 - $650 (pair) on ebay. You might be able to find them cheaper somewhere else.
http://cgi.ebay.com/ebaymotors/ws/eB...category=33710
http://cgi.ebay.com/ebaymotors/ws/eB...category=33710

the clear bi-xenon headlamps will cost you $1200 (pair) if you purchase them from Steve. He also sells the clear fog lamps for $150 (pair). Here is a set I found on ebay.
http://cgi.ebay.com/ebaymotors/ws/eB...category=36476

Another option for the clear foglights is to buy the clear foglight glass covers and just replace them yourself. The fog lights use a glass cover that can be easily removed (once the bumper is removed) from the foglight casing. Your stock fogs use a frosted glass cover now. I believe the clear glass can be purchased at any MB dealership parts dept for $22 each. Here are the part #'s....

A 203 826 01 90 ......Clear Foglight Lens (Driver Side)
A 203 826 02 90 ......Clear Foglight Lens (Passenger Side)

Below is a link to pics of the stock fogs modified with the clear glass cover (left) and a oem clear fog light that can be purchased for $150 from Steve (right).

http://groups.msn.com/mbenznl/europa...o&PhotoID=2380

None of these prices include installation. I installed mine myself and it was fairly simple as long as you have patience and can follow directions. You can find the installation instructions at http://www.buellwinkle.com/howtobumper.html
You can also have them installed by some members on this forum for $150. Mark_Cummins in Huntington Beach will install it for $150.

I believe if you purchase the bi-xenons from Steve, he will install them for free...but you need to double check on that. He will not install anything that you don't purchase from him.
